Why Your Dangle Earrings Deserve Special Storage

Dangle earrings aren’t just accessories — they’re delicate engineering. With chains, drops, hoops, and often lightweight metals like gold-filled or sterling silver, they need airflow, separation, and vertical support to prevent kinking, scratching, and oxidation. A standard velvet-lined tray or flat drawer? It’s like storing spaghetti in a shoebox — everything sticks, tangles, and loses its shape.

NAPO-certified organizers recommend vertical display with individual anchoring points as the gold standard for dangle earrings. Why? Because gravity becomes your ally — not your enemy. When earrings hang freely, their weight helps them settle into natural alignment, reducing stress on posts and backs while preserving finish and movement.

Renter-Friendly Tip: The “No-Hole Promise” Checklist

If you’re renting, avoid permanent installations — but don’t sacrifice function. Use this checklist before purchasing or installing:

  • ✅ All mounting hardware must use 3M Command Strips rated for ≥5 lbs (e.g., Command Large Picture Hanging Strips or Command Hooks for Heavy-Duty Use)
  • ✅ Wall surfaces must be smooth, painted drywall or wood — not textured plaster, brick, or wallpaper
  • ✅ Total assembled weight (including earrings) must stay under 80% of strip weight rating (e.g., 5-lb strip → max 4 lbs loaded)
  • ✅ Always test adhesion: Press firmly for 30 seconds, wait 1 hour, then gently tug before loading
  • ❌ Never use over-door hooks on hollow-core interior doors — they shift, scratch, and void lease agreements

What to Look For: 7 Must-Have Features (Not Just Pretty Looks)

A beautiful jewelry box for dangle earrings won’t help if it fails the real-world test. Here’s what NAPO and ASTM standards say matters most — backed by actual measurements and material science:

  1. Peg or hook spacing ≥1.25" — Prevents chain entanglement. Anything tighter than 1.125" causes 3x more snags (per 2022 textile durability study, Journal of Home Organization).
  2. Hook diameter ≥1/8" (0.125") — Thinner wires bend under weight; thicker ones damage earring posts. Stainless steel or brass-plated steel recommended.
  3. Base depth ≥3" — Ensures dangling elements (drops, charms, tassels) hang freely without touching bottom or neighboring pairs.
  4. Cubic storage volume ≥0.8 ft³ — Enough for 25–40 dangle pairs + extras (backings, travel pouches, polishing cloths).
  5. Non-porous surface — Avoid fabric-lined boxes unless fully removable/washable. Velvet traps moisture and accelerates tarnish in humid climates.
  6. Soft-close or cushioned base — Protects delicate findings. Look for silicone bumpers or microfiber lining (not foam — it off-gasses).
  7. UV-resistant material — Acrylic should meet ISO 4892-3 Class 1 UV stability rating to prevent yellowing within 3 years.

For Humid Climates or Coastal Homes

Moisture is the #1 enemy of metal finishes. Add these protective layers:

  • Include reusable silica gel packets (2g capacity, replace every 6 months) inside closed compartments
  • Line drawers with anti-tarnish paper (such as Pacific Silvercloth®) — proven to extend shine 3–5x longer in 75%+ humidity
  • Avoid vacuum-seal storage for dangle earrings — compression stresses solder joints and bends delicate wires

People Also Ask: Quick Answers to Real Questions

Can I use a regular jewelry box for dangle earrings?
No — standard boxes lack vertical support. Chains tangle, drops kink, and posts get bent. Reserve those for studs, cuffs, or pendants.
What’s the best material for a jewelry box for dangle earrings?
Stainless steel hooks + acrylic or solid hardwood body. Avoid MDF (swells with humidity) and untreated pine (resin leaches onto metal).
How many dangle earrings fit in a 12-inch-wide organizer?
With 1.25" peg spacing: up to 10 pairs per 12" width. So a 24" unit holds ~20 pairs comfortably — add 20% buffer for airflow and ease of access.
Are magnetic jewelry organizers safe for dangle earrings?
Only if magnets are neodymium-free and embedded in non-ferrous housing. Most magnetic spice racks (like SimpleHouseware Magnetic Strip Rack) are too strong and risk pulling posts loose. Skip magnets — pegs win every time.
Do I need a locking jewelry box for dangle earrings?
Only if storing high-value pieces (e.g., heirloom diamonds or vintage gold). For everyday wear, focus on secure mounting (ASTM F2057 compliant) over locks — which add complexity and cost.
Can I DIY a jewelry box for dangle earrings safely?
Yes — but skip hot glue and thin wire. Use 1/8" stainless steel rods epoxied into pre-drilled hardwood, or repurpose blinds valance brackets (rated for 15+ lbs) mounted with Command Strips. Always test load before adding earrings.
